| In May of 1998 my father gave me directions to the "old family homestead" where he had grown up in Mineville, Nova Scotia. My visit there to see the ruins of the old house my father was raised in and the Shaw family cemetery, and to see for the first time the names of my great-grandparents and great-great-grandparents, was the beginning of a search for my ancestors that has introduced me to "cousins" all around the world. It is no easy feat researching a family tree! How and where to find the names of ancestors, who often went by middle- or nick-names; not realizing that they did not come directly to their last known place of residence but through some other part of the country; surnames that were shortened or Anglicized after arriving in North America; family stories and legends littered with just enough mis-information to throw you completely off track; dead-ends and "brick walls" that sometimes seem insurmountable. I'm sure anyone who has spent time looking for family can empathize! I am fortunate that I was able to start much farther back on my tree than many other people can. I count myself extremely lucky that my mother was still alive and able to recall an amazing amount of detail about not only her own parents and their families, but my fathers parents and their families as well. I was also very lucky in that quite a few of my ancestors have been well documented by other researchers before me and it was simply a matter of connecting to one of their unfinished branches.
